For much of the past decade, bonds were the "boring" part of a portfolio, offering little more than a place to park cash. But in 2026, fixed income has re-established its role as a powerful engine for income and stability. With the Federal Reserve expected to continue rate cuts toward a target of by year-end, the strategy for 2026 isn't just about if you should buy bonds, but which ones will best capture this shifting landscape.
